What the data shows in Great Barton

Collisions in Great Barton are most frequently recorded on a Wednesday (20.5% of the total), with 20.5% happening in darkness rather than daylight. The most common posted speed limit at the scene is 30 mph.

98.6% of recorded collisions in Great Barton happen on a single carriageway. Around 5.5% were recorded in adverse weather such as rain, snow or fog.

The collisions in Great Barton have produced 110 casualties. Pedestrians account for 7.3% of those casualties, a marker of the risk to people on foot here.

Where does the road accident data for Great Barton come from?

It comes from STATS19, the official record of personal-injury road collisions reported to the police and published by the Department for Transport. The figures for Great Barton cover 1999 to 2024.
